I’ve been trying to log in to the app via my iPhone and keep getting error code 400518009, “ sorry we can’t seem to connect, check your connection”.
is there a solution for this error yet?

Another customer was having a similar problem early last year. Here's what he said:
"
I was experiencing the same issue. Of course, contacting Southwest via Twitter yielded nothing but flatulence. I eventually figured out that because I used the copy/paste functionality of my Iphone (8, IOS 11.2.6) and didn't physically type in my RR#, that caused the data that the login page sees for the username to be invalidated, thereby causing the error.
Its always hit and miss with the app developers whether they will allow cut and paste functionality in certain fields on any sign-in page... In this case, Southwest does not ... Hope this helps someone! "
